数控编程和代码的关系是什么

不及物动词 其他 39

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数控编程和代码之间存在密切的关系。数控编程是通过编写代码来控制数控机床进行加工操作的过程。代码是数控编程的具体表达方式,是一种用于描述加工操作过程的指令集合。

    首先,数控编程是基于代码的。在进行数控编程时,需要根据具体的加工需求和工件的几何形状等因素,编写相应的代码。代码中包含了一系列的指令,用于控制数控机床进行加工操作,如刀具路径、切削速度、进给速度、坐标轴运动等。通过编写代码,可以精确地描述加工操作的过程。

    其次,代码决定了数控机床的运动轨迹和加工参数。在数控编程中,通过编写代码来指定数控机床的运动路径和加工参数。代码中的指令可以控制数控机床的各个坐标轴的运动,包括直线运动、圆弧运动等。同时,代码还可以指定加工的切削速度、进给速度、切削深度等参数,以确保加工质量和效率。

    最后,代码的正确性对于数控编程至关重要。编写正确的代码可以确保数控机床能够按照预期进行加工操作,从而得到符合要求的工件。而错误的代码可能导致加工过程出现问题,如工件尺寸偏差、表面质量不佳等。因此,在进行数控编程时,需要仔细检查和验证代码的正确性,确保代码与实际加工需求相匹配。

    综上所述,数控编程和代码是密不可分的。代码是数控编程的具体表达方式,通过编写代码可以精确地描述加工操作过程,并指导数控机床进行加工。代码的正确性对于数控编程和加工结果的质量起着重要的作用。因此,掌握数控编程和代码的关系对于数控加工技术的应用具有重要意义。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数控编程与代码密切相关,代码是数控编程的基础和核心内容。下面是数控编程与代码的关系的五个要点:

    1. 数控编程是将加工工艺和工作过程转化为机器可以理解和执行的代码的过程。数控编程是根据零件的几何形状、尺寸和加工要求,编写相应的程序指令,控制数控机床进行加工操作。这些程序指令就是代码,它们告诉数控机床如何移动刀具、切削工件、改变切削参数等。

    2. 数控编程语言是用于编写数控程序的语言,常见的数控编程语言有G代码和M代码。G代码是数控机床的基本指令,用于控制机床的运动轨迹、进给速度、切削方式等。M代码是机床的辅助功能指令,用于控制机床的辅助动作,如换刀、冷却等。数控编程语言是代码的具体表现形式,通过编写这些代码,可以实现对数控机床的精确控制。

    3. 数控编程中的代码包括多个方面的内容,如切削参数、进给速度、刀具路径、切削方式等。通过编写代码,程序员可以根据加工工艺要求,设置适当的切削参数,如切削速度、进给量、切削深度等,以实现对工件的精确加工。同时,代码也包括刀具路径的设计,即刀具在加工过程中的移动轨迹,通过编写代码,可以指导数控机床按照预定的路径进行切削操作。

    4. 数控编程的代码是由数控编程软件生成的。数控编程软件是一种专门用于编写数控程序的软件工具,它提供了丰富的功能和工具,可以帮助程序员快速、准确地编写代码。数控编程软件通常具有图形化界面,可以通过图形化的方式设计刀具路径,并将其转化为相应的代码。程序员可以通过数控编程软件输入工件的几何信息、切削参数等,然后软件会自动生成相应的数控程序代码。

    5. 数控编程中的代码也可以进行调试和优化。在编写完代码后,程序员可以通过数控仿真软件对代码进行调试和优化。数控仿真软件可以将代码在虚拟环境中运行,模拟数控机床的加工过程,以验证代码的正确性和效果。如果发现问题或需要改进,程序员可以对代码进行修改和优化,以提高加工质量和效率。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数控编程和代码有着密切的关系。数控编程是指将工件的加工要求转化为数控机床可以识别和执行的程序,而代码是数控编程的具体表达形式。

    一、数控编程的基本概念
    数控编程是指将加工要求转化为数控机床可以识别和执行的程序,以实现工件的自动加工。数控编程是数控加工的基础,通过编写数控程序,可以指导数控机床进行各种精密加工操作,如铣削、钻孔、车削等。

    二、代码的作用
    代码是数控编程的具体表达形式,是指导数控机床运行的指令序列。通过编写代码,可以指定数控机床的加工路径、切削速度、进给速度、切削深度等加工参数,从而实现工件的自动化加工。代码的作用类似于人类语言中的指令,通过解读和执行代码,数控机床可以按照程序要求进行精确的加工操作。

    三、数控编程的基本要素
    1.几何要素:指工件的几何形状和尺寸信息,包括点、直线、圆弧、曲线等。几何要素是数控编程的基础,通过描述工件的几何形状,可以确定加工路径和切削轨迹。

    2.尺寸要素:指工件的尺寸信息,包括直径、长度、宽度等。尺寸要素是数控编程的重要组成部分,通过指定工件的尺寸,可以确定加工的精度和尺寸要求。

    3.运动要素:指数控机床的运动方式和加工过程中的各种参数,包括切削速度、进给速度、切削深度等。运动要素是数控编程的核心,通过指定运动要素,可以控制数控机床的运动轨迹和加工过程。

    4.程序要素:指数控编程中的各种指令和命令,包括加工指令、换刀指令、切换工具指令等。程序要素是数控编程的指导规范,通过编写程序要素,可以指导数控机床按照要求进行加工操作。

    四、数控编程的操作流程
    1.确定加工要求:根据工件的加工要求和尺寸要求,确定数控编程的目标和要求。

    2.选择编程方式:根据加工要求和数控机床的特点,选择合适的编程方式,如手工编程、自动编程或CAM软件编程。

    3.编写数控程序:根据几何要素、尺寸要素和运动要素,编写数控程序,包括加工路径、切削速度、进给速度、切削深度等加工参数。

    4.调试程序:将编写好的数控程序输入数控机床,进行调试和试运行,检查程序是否符合要求,调整和修正程序中的错误。

    5.加工工件:将调试好的程序加载到数控机床中,进行工件的自动化加工,观察加工结果是否符合要求。

    6.优化程序:根据实际加工情况,优化数控程序,改进加工效率和加工质量。

    五、数控编程的发展趋势
    随着科技的不断发展,数控编程也在不断进步和发展。目前,数控编程已经向智能化、自动化方向发展,通过引入人工智能、机器学习等技术,实现数控编程的自动化和智能化,提高编程的效率和精度。

    总结:数控编程和代码是密不可分的,代码是数控编程的具体表达形式,通过编写代码可以指导数控机床进行加工操作。数控编程的基本要素包括几何要素、尺寸要素、运动要素和程序要素,通过编写数控程序可以实现工件的自动化加工。数控编程的操作流程包括确定加工要求、选择编程方式、编写数控程序、调试程序、加工工件和优化程序等。随着科技的发展,数控编程也在不断进步和发展,向智能化、自动化方向发展。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部